Skip to content

Commit bd4529a

Browse files
committed
[process][windows] Refator a tiny bit is32BitProcess() function to be more idiomatic Go
1 parent 400a453 commit bd4529a

File tree

1 file changed

+2
-8
lines changed

1 file changed

+2
-8
lines changed

process/process_windows.go

+2-8
Original file line numberDiff line numberDiff line change
@@ -987,15 +987,9 @@ func is32BitProcess(h windows.Handle) bool {
987987

988988
var procIs32Bits bool
989989
switch processorArchitecture {
990-
case PROCESSOR_ARCHITECTURE_INTEL:
991-
fallthrough
992-
case PROCESSOR_ARCHITECTURE_ARM:
990+
case PROCESSOR_ARCHITECTURE_INTEL, PROCESSOR_ARCHITECTURE_ARM:
993991
procIs32Bits = true
994-
case PROCESSOR_ARCHITECTURE_ARM64:
995-
fallthrough
996-
case PROCESSOR_ARCHITECTURE_IA64:
997-
fallthrough
998-
case PROCESSOR_ARCHITECTURE_AMD64:
992+
case PROCESSOR_ARCHITECTURE_ARM64, PROCESSOR_ARCHITECTURE_IA64, PROCESSOR_ARCHITECTURE_AMD64:
999993
var wow64 uint
1000994

1001995
ret, _, _ := common.ProcNtQueryInformationProcess.Call(

0 commit comments

Comments
 (0)